Caramel Crunch Cheesecake Fruit Salad

  • Total Time: 20 minutes
  • Yield: Serves approximately 6

Ingredients

Scale
  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• ¼ cup powdered sugar
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 cup heavy whipping cream
  • 2 cups strawberries, halved
  • 2 cups green grapes
  • 1 cup red grapes
  • ½ cup caramel sauce
  • ¼ cup crushed graham cracker crumbs or cookie crumbs
  • ¼ cup chopped peanuts or pecans

Instructions

  1. In a mixing bowl, beat softened cream cheese with powdered sugar and vanilla extract until smooth.
  2. In another bowl, whip heavy cream until stiff peaks form.
  3. Gently fold whipped cream into the cream cheese mixture until well combined.
  4. Cut the mixture into small squares and chill in the fridge for 30 minutes.
  5. In a serving dish, layer halved strawberries, green grapes, red grapes, and chilled cheesecake bites.
  6. Top with crushed graham cracker crumbs and chopped nuts. Drizzle caramel sauce on top before serving.
